The Evolution of Medical Licensure
For years, medical boards ran through manual "primary source verification." This meant every state board would separately get in touch with a physician's medical school, residency program, and testing centers to validate credentials. In the digital age, much of this has actually been centralized through organizations like the Federation of State Medical Boards (FSMB).
The shift to online systems aims to decrease the "credentialing burden" on doctors. By using centralized online repositories, medical professionals can keep their credentials in a digital vault, permitting state boards to access validated information with the click of a button.
Key Digital Platforms in the Licensing Process
Several central platforms assist in the online licensing procedure in the United States and abroad. Comprehending these tools is the initial step towards a successful application.
1. The Federation Credentials Verification Service (FCVS)
The FCVS functions as a permanent online repository for a doctor's primary source validated credentials. Instead of a doctor asking their medical school to send out transcripts to 5 various states, the FCVS confirms the files once and hosts them digitally for any board that requires them.
2. The Uniform Application (UA)
The UA is a web-based application developed to remove redundant data entry. Many state boards have actually adopted this system, allowing applicants to submit their core information as soon as and then add state-specific requirements.
3. The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C)
The IMLC is an agreement amongst taking part U.S. states to substantially streamline the licensing process for doctors who wish to practice in multiple states. This is the closest the market has actually pertained to a "one-click" online license for qualified prospects.

For doctors focused on telemedicine or those living near state borders, the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C) is the most efficient online "faster way."
To utilize the IMLC, a doctor should designate a State of Principal License (SPL). If the SPL is a member of the compact, the physician can apply for an "Expedited License" in any other member state by means of the IMLC's online portal.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I get a medical license entirely online without going to medical school?
No. An online "medical license" that does not need evidence of an MD/DO degree and residency is a scam. The online procedure refers only to the administrative application for legitimate, skilled physicians.
2. How long does the online licensing process take?
Typically, a standard online application takes in between 2 to 4 months. Using the IMLC can reduce this to under 30 days for those who qualify.
3. Is the FCVS needed for all online applications?
No, however it is highly advised. Many states require it, and for those that don't, it still simplifies the process of sending qualifications to multiple boards.
4. Can global medical graduates (IMGs) use for a license online?
Yes. Both the FCVS and the Uniform Application accommodate IMGs, supplied they have their ECFMG certification and have actually completed the necessary residency requirements in the United States or Canada.
